With some more additional and simplifying assumptions, the impedance diagram can be simplified further to obtain the corresponding reactance diagram. The following are the assumptions made.

The reactance diagram is similar to the impedance diagram, with the exception that loads of rotating machines are usually neglected as they have no significant effect on line currents during a fault.
